Beach Tennis Road Swing Continues At LMU
2/4/2015 12:00:00 AM | Women's Tennis
LONG BEACH, Calif. - The season-opening road trip continues this week as the No. 40 Long Beach State women's tennis team heads to LMU for a Friday match. The lone match of the week concludes the three-match road swing for the Beach to open the dual season.
REGULAR SEASON WIN STREAK
· With a pair of victories last week, the Beach extended its regular win streak into double digits. Beach tennis has won 10 regular season matches in a row, dating back to March 19 of last year.
· During the streak, the Beach has won by a score of at least 5-2 nine out of 10 times. Only Harvard pushed the Beach to 4-3 in the last 10 regular season matches.
THE OPPONENTS
· LMU enters this Friday's match with a 1-3 record. However, all three losses have come to ranked opponents, including a narrow 4-3 loss to No. 73 UC Irvine in its last match.
COUNT UP TO 300
· Head coach Jenny Hilt-Costello is already the school record holder for career wins and is closing in on another milestone this season. With two wins last week, Hilt-Costello picked up career wins Nos. 293 and 294.
· With just six more wins to go to reach the benchmark, Hilt-Costello could reach 300 as early as Feb. 28 if the Beach remains unbeaten.
THREE PLAYERS STILL UNBEATEN
· Three 49ers remained unbeaten through the first two dual matches of the season. Karolina Rozenberg, Laura Eales and Julie Gerard all won both doubles and singles matchups last weekend to start the spring 4-0.
· Rozenberg continued her sparkling senior season, improving to 13-2 in singles this year and 11-3 in doubles. She is up to 145 career wins.
· The Beach was also perfect at seven of the nine lineup slots in its first two matches. With the three undefeated players leading the way, Beach tennis did not drop a match at Nos. 3-6 singles or Nos. 2-3 doubles.
